Xml software definition




















An XML map and its data source information are saved with the Excel workbook, not a specific worksheet. Furthermore, if you save your workbook as a macro-enabled Excel Office Open XML Format File, this map information can be viewed through Microsoft Notepad or through another text-editing program. If you want to keep using the map information but remove the potentially sensitive data source information, you can delete the data source definition of the XML schema from the workbook, but still export the XML data, by clearing the Save data source definition in workbook check box in the XML Map Properties dialog box, which is available from the Map Properties command in the XML group on the Developer tab.

If you delete a worksheet before you delete a map, the map information about the data sources, and possibly other sensitive information, is still saved in the workbook. If you are updating the workbook to remove sensitive information, make sure that you delete the XML map before you delete the worksheet, so that the map information is permanently removed from the workbook.

When you import data, you bind the data from the file to an XML map that is stored in your workbook. Validate data against schema for import and export Specifies whether Excel validates data against the XML map when importing data. Overwrite existing data with new data Specifies whether data is overwritten when you import data. Click this option when you want to replace the current data with new data, for example, when up-to-date data is contained in the new XML data file.

Append new data to existing XML tables Specifies whether the contents of the data source are appended to the existing data on the worksheet. Click this option, for example, when you are consolidating data from several similar XML data files into an XML table, or you do not want to overwrite the contents of a cell that contains a function. When you import XML data, you may want to overwrite some mapped cells but not others.

For example, some mapped cells may contain formulas and you don't want to overwrite the formula when you import an XML file. There are two approaches that you can take:. Unmap the elements that you don't want overwritten, before you import the XML data. After you import the XML data, you can remap the XML element to the cells containing the formulas, so that you can export the results of the formulas to the XML data file.

In this "Import" XML map, don't map elements to the cells that contain formulas or other data that you don't want overwritten. Use another XML map for exporting the data. If you open a workbook that was created in Excel , you can still view the data, but you cannot edit or refresh the source data. The inferred schema is stored with the workbook, and the inferred schema allows you to work with XML data if an XML schema file isn't associated with the workbook.

Select the Preview Data in Task Pane option from the Options button to display the first row of data as sample data in the element list, if you imported XML data associated with the XML map in the current session of Excel. You cannot export the Excel inferred schema as a separate XML schema data file.

Although there are XML schema editors and other methods for creating an XML schema file, you may not have convenient access to them or know how to use them. You export XML data by exporting the contents of mapped cells on the worksheet. When you export data, Excel applies the following rules to determine what data to save and how to save it:. Empty items are not created when blank cells exist for an optional element, but empty items are created when blank cells exist for a required element.

Excel overwrites existing namespace prefixes. The default namespace is assigned a prefix of ns0. Excel has a defined XML schema that defines the contents of an Excel workbook, including XML tags that store all workbook information, such as data and properties, and define the overall structure of the workbook.

For example, developers may want to create a custom application to search for data in multiple workbooks that are saved in the this format and create a reporting system based on the data found. You can always ask an expert in the Excel Tech Community or get support in the Answers community. Import XML data. Export XML data.

Append or overwrite mapped XML data. Need more help? Expand your skills. Get new features first. Was this information helpful? So what exactly is a markup language? Markup is information added to a document that enhances its meaning in certain ways, in that it identifies the parts and how they relate to each other. More specifically, a markup language is a set of symbols that can be placed in the text of a document to demarcate and label the parts of that document.

A programming language consists of grammar rules and its own vocabulary which is used to create computer programs. These programs instruct the computer to perform specific tasks. XML does not qualify to be a programming language as it does not perform any computation or algorithms. XML is commonly used for documents that are in multiple languages or where there are multiple variants that serve the needs of different users.

XML can, for example, be used to differentiate learning content for visually impaired learners. You simply create rules that will determine how the data is handled by different applications. One other potential advantage to using XML is that some processing can be moved client-side as opposed to server-side.

In HTML, you use tags that are pre-determined and have been defined in the language standard. With XML, you get to define your own tags. XML is designed in a way that allows individual industries to use their own vocabulary and create their own document structures. XML is used for data and content management in many industries. Industries have created their own standards for XML documents.

A number of new languages have been based off XML. They are designed to meet the very specific needs of particular industries. XML can be an efficient way of storing video and other multimedia.



0コメント

  • 1000 / 1000